In a dystopian near-future, singles are forcibly paired or face a gruesome fate: transforming into beasts and fleeing to the woods. One desperate man flees The Hotel, only to find himself in a forbidden romance with a fellow loner, threatening to upend the societal norms of love and freedom in this darkly comedic thrill ride.

David's Arrival at the Hotel

David arrives at a peculiar hotel after his wife leaves him for another man. The hotel manager immediately informs him of the strict rule that singles have just 45 days to find a partner or they will be transformed into an animal of their choice.

Introduction to Hotel Guests

At the hotel, David meets other guests, including Robert and John, who share peculiar traits. They discuss the absurdities of their situation, where superficial physical similarities become the basis for compatibility in this bizarre environment.

The Absurd Hotel Rules

David learns about the ridiculous rules of the hotel, such as the prohibition on masturbation and the requirement for guests to receive sexual stimulation from the maids. He is forced to attend mandatory dances that promote the benefits of being in a couple.

Hunting the Loners

Guests at the hotel are encouraged to hunt down 'loners,' individuals who live in the forest and refuse relationships. Capturing a loner grants them an extra day in their quest to find a partner, demonstrating the lengths they will go to avoid transformation.

The Biscuit Woman's Despair

During a group hunting trip, David encounters a woman obsessed with butter biscuits who expresses her despair about being single. She reveals her intent to end her life by jumping from the hotel window if she does not find a partner.

John's Scheme

John cleverly attracts the attention of a woman with frequent nosebleeds by injuring himself, which allows them to be paired together. This strategy reflects the length to which guests will go to find compatibility, regardless of authenticity.

David's Encounter with the Ruthless Woman

David decides to pursue a ruthless woman known for tranquilizing loners. Their initial interaction is interrupted by the cries of the biscuit woman who has jumped from a window, adding to the chaos of the hotel.

Developing a Connection

David and the ruthless woman bond over time spent in a hot tub, where she pretends to choke to test his feelings. Her satisfaction with his indifference leads to them moving in together as a couple.

Betrayal and Grief

David wakes up to find his brother Bob brutally killed by his new partner. This shocking discovery leads him to realize that their relationship is based on manipulation, prompting him to plan his escape.

David's Escape

With the help of a sympathetic maid, who is secretly a loner spy, David tranquilizes his partner and flees the hotel. This marks a pivotal moment as he moves from enforced relationships to the freedom of being a loner.

Life Among the Loners

David joins the loners, who adhere to strict rules about romance to avoid punishment. He bonds with a woman who shares his short-sightedness, and they establish a unique method of communication through gestures.

The Loner's Mission

Together, David and the short-sighted woman embark on secret missions into the city, posing as a married couple. Their newfound freedom provides a taste of joy and companionship they both secretly cherish.

The Raid on the Hotel

The loners plan a raid on the hotel, resulting in tension between both sides. David informs the woman with nosebleeds about John's deception, deepening the conflict as the loners confront the hotel staff.

The Cruel Twist

The leader of the loners captures the short-sighted woman, planning to blindfold her under false pretenses. In a chaotic confrontation, the leader manipulates situations to maintain control over her group.

David's Final Decision

Facing the harsh reality of his circumstances, David contemplates a drastic action in a city restroom. He hesitates to blind himself with a steak knife, symbolizing his struggle between love and the absurdity of his situation.
